Class RoutingManager
Inheritance
RoutingManager
Assembly: NXOpen.dll
Syntax
public class RoutingManager : NXRemotableObject, IMessageSink
Constructors
RoutingManager(Session)
Declaration
protected RoutingManager(Session owner)
Parameters
Type |
Name |
Description |
Session |
owner |
|
Properties
BuilderFactory
Declaration
public BuilderFactory BuilderFactory { get; }
Property Value
Tag
Declaration
Property Value
Methods
DeleteDerivatives(DerivativeDevice[])
Declaration
public void DeleteDerivatives(DerivativeDevice[] derivatives)
Parameters
DeleteWiringData(Part)
Declaration
public void DeleteWiringData(Part harenssPart)
Parameters
Type |
Name |
Description |
Part |
harenssPart |
|
GetRoutingManager(Session)
Declaration
public static RoutingManager GetRoutingManager(Session owner)
Parameters
Type |
Name |
Description |
Session |
owner |
|
Returns
GetWiringComponents(Component)
Declaration
public Component[] GetWiringComponents(Component rootPart)
Parameters
Returns
SetActiveWiringComponent(Part, Component)
Declaration
public void SetActiveWiringComponent(Part rootPart, Component activeWiringComp)
Parameters
ShowOnlyDerivatives(DerivativeDevice[])
Declaration
public void ShowOnlyDerivatives(DerivativeDevice[] derivatives)
Parameters
Implements
System.Runtime.Remoting.Messaging.IMessageSink